Keep your Kick and Bass perfectly in the center (Mono). Take your shakers, claps, and Darbuka slaps and pan them slightly left and right to create a wide, immersive soundstage.

Place a kick on every main beat (1, 2, 3, 4). For more "bounce," increase the kick velocity or add an extra hit just before the third beat.
